sipHomeDomainProxyStaticHost

MX-SIP-MIB · .1.3.6.1.4.1.4935.15.1.70.10.5

Object

scalar r/w MX-TCMxIpHostName
SIP proxy server IP address or domain name.
          
An intermediary entity that acts as both a server and
a client for the purpose of making requests on behalf
of other clients. A proxy server primarily plays the role
of routing, which means its job is to ensure that a request
is passed on to another entity that can further process
the request. Proxies are also useful for enforcing policy
and for firewall traversal. A proxy interprets, and, if necessary,
rewrites parts of a request message before forwarding it.
          
Note: If using a domain name that is bound to a SRV record,
see sipHomeDomainProxyStaticPort.
